Vikesrock 05-03-2010 21:30

Re: 2010 Regional Webcasts
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by Formerly Famous (Post 931883)
On a quick side note. Does anyone have a rough guess as to how long until TBA gets videos online?

This is typically dependent on how quickly a team archiving the footage (assuming there is one) gets the video cut and uploaded to the TBA FTP. After it is on the TBA FTP those guys are usually great about getting it posted.

If the video is being parsed in real-time during archiving, it could be uploaded and posted within a day or two. Most likely it will take longer, usually at least a few days to a week.
